Your new Job:
This is an exciting opportunity to join the Solution and Innovation team to provide administrative support to our various Product Managers. As a Product Administrator, you will be responsible for the coordination, planning, scheduling, and reporting of all development activities tied to product and client initiatives.
This role is part of a small team of specialists we are bringing together to provide systems administration continuity for the organization. The team will be part of the Commercial function, working closely alongside our Product and Key Account Managers who will provide strategic product direction and customer relationship management.
Your Responsibilities:
- Maintaining the development backlog to ensure tickets are prioritized & groomed appropriately
- Participates in sprint planning meetings to ensure delivery commitments are being met
- Participates in sprint retrospective meetings and providing feedback to the Product Manager
- Attends daily sprint dev stand-ups
- Prepares all required reporting
- Clearing obstacles
- Ensuring a good relationship between the team and product managers as well as others outside the team
- Protecting the team from outside interruptions and distractions.
Your Skills and Experience:
- Working knowledge of development and BI tools (Jira, SalesForce, Roadmunk, Power BI)
- Excellent communication skills
- Keen eye for detail
- Analytical mind and strong quantitative skills
- Can work within tight timescales
- Thinks creatively
- Will work well in a team and with a wide range of people
- Is proactive and able to take the initiative
- Is able to motivate and inspire a team
- Is persuasive and diplomatic
Beneficial Skills and Experience:
- Agile Principles
